Why Effective Policies Matter for Energy Storage
Imagine a world where solar panels generate excess power during the day, but there's nowhere to store it. Without robust storage policies, this energy goes to waste. The best energy storage power station policy addresses such gaps by:
- Encouraging investments in battery and pumped-hydro systems
- Standardizing safety protocols for large-scale projects
- Providing tax rebates or subsidies to reduce upfront costs
Case Study: Policy Success in Leading Markets
| Country | Policy Mechanism | Result (2023 Data) |
|---|---|---|
| Germany | Feed-in Tariffs + Storage Grants | 1.2 GW added storage capacity |
| USA | Investment Tax Credit (ITC) | 45% cost reduction for lithium-ion systems |
| China | Mandatory Storage for Solar Farms | 18% grid efficiency improvement |

Industry-Specific Solutions: Powering Multiple Sectors
Energy storage isn't a one-size-fits-all game. Here's how tailored policies serve different industries:
- Renewables: Smoothing wind/solar output fluctuations
- Manufacturing: Peak shaving to cut energy bills
- Residential: Backup power during outages

FAQ: Energy Storage Policies Demystified
Q: How long does it take to see ROI under current policies? A: Most projects break even in 3-5 years with incentives like ITC or feed-in tariffs.
Q: Do policies differ for residential vs. industrial storage? A: Yes—residential systems often have simplified permitting, while industrial projects require environmental impact assessments.
Q: Can small businesses benefit from storage policies? A: Absolutely! Many regions offer grants for SMEs adopting storage to reduce operational costs.
